41% of Filipinos support charter change — survey

ONE of the proponents of Constitutional amendments welcomed the growing interest of Filipinos in changing the 1987 Constitution.

Cagayan de Oro Rep. Rufus Rodriguez, chairman of the House Committee on Constitutional Amendments, said the new survey results released by Pulse Asia on Tuesday showed that 41 percent of Filipinos are supportive of amending the 1987 Constitution .

Based on the Pulse Asia survey conducted from March 15-19, 2023, 41 percent of Filipino adults agree that the 1987 Constitution should be amended as compared to 31 percent during the September 2022 survey.

The survey also showed that those who are against amending the 1987 Constitution have decreased from 56 percent last September to 45 percent during the March 2023 survey.

“We are getting there. This shows that more and more Filipinos are now realizing the need to amend the Constitution to help the country move forward and to attract more investments,” Rodriguez said.

The survey also showed that 34 percent of Filipino adults also agree with the formation of a constitutional convention to amend our Constitution while only 30 percent are opposed to the constitutional convention mode.

The survey added that 47 percent of Filipino adults were aware that there are proposals to amend the 1987 Constitution.

Rodriguez believes that this number can still be improved thru information campaigns conducted by the House of Representatives in most provinces and cities in the Philippines.

He will propose holding of various constitutional caravans all over the country to further increase awareness and inform the people of the benefits of amending the restrictive economic provisions of the constitution.

However, the survey highlighted that those against (45 percent) the Constitutional amendments are still higher than those in favor (41 percent) of it.

The number of those opposed reached 51 percent in Mindanao, 40 percent in Visayas and 39 percent in Balance Luzon.

In the National Capital Region (NCR), those against turned higher with 59 percent compared to September 2022 survey of 54 percent.

At the same time, the number of Filipinos with little to no knowledge of the 1987 Constitution went up to 79 percent from 73 percent in September 2022.
